UMOA-securities: Togo secures CFA33 billion on the regional money market

(Togo First) - Last Friday, Togo secured CFA33 billion on the UMOA securities market. While that is the amount Lomé retained, it mobilized around CFA59 in the related issue. 

The country raised the funds through a simultaneous issue of Treasury Recovery Bonds (OdR), with the bonds having a nominal value of CFA10,000. 

According to the UMOA securities agency, the two issues will mature over five and seven years, respectively. They have an interest rate of 5.7% and 5.9%, distinctly.

The agency added that Togolese authorities will use the operation’s proceeds to finance their budget, in line with efforts to recover from Covid-19 and return to pre-pandemic performances.
